Part 1 - Let’s talk about vitamins and minerals: Little known tips about vitamins and minerals
- Taking Vitamin C when you eat processed foods can neutralize the nitrates and nitrites in them.
- Vitamins B and C are destroyed when they are boiled, so eat more raw veggies instead of boiling or steaming them!
- Taking B Vitamins can help you avoid hangover symptoms that can be caused by even a small amount of alcohol.
- There are many other vitamins and minerals that are affected by alcohol, so take those during or after you have a glass of wine or a couple of beers.
- Eating a high protein diet can cause you to lose calcium through your urine, so if you eat a lot of meat, you might need to take extra calcium supplements.
